Allyson,

Here’s one way:

Pencil Sketch

1. With the original image open, duplicate the layer. =(Layer 1)

2. Desaturate Layer 1 (Image/ Adjustments/Desaturate)

3. Duplicate layer 1. =(Layer 2)

4. Invert layer 2. (Image/adjustments/invert)

5. Change the blending mode of layer 2 to Color Dodge.
The display will turn completely white.

6. Apply a gaussian blur to layer 2. The amount of blur will determine the width of the sketch lines.

You can try different blurring tools. eg median, multiple cycles of despeckle etc.

You can now delete the original layer or you can move it above Layer 2 and reduce the opacity to get a watercolor look to the sketch.
